How about looking at the reasons WHY there are so many prosecutions?
A law that is being broken THIS much obviously lacks credibility.
Increasing the penalties will not address the credibility problem, and could have undesirable side-effects such as more people driving without insurance or driving while disqualified.
Unless you plan to start shooting people, fear alone will not ensure compliance with laws that many consider to be unjust. The benefits to society have to be more clearly demostrated than what they're being at present.
